Screen

Technology TFT TFT
Touchscreen capacitive touchscreen capacitive touchscreen
Display colors 16M 65K
Screen size 3.2" in 4.3" in
Screen area 31.7 cm2 52.6 cm2
Screen format 4:3 (height:width) 5:3 (height:width)
Screen to body ratio 49.2% 65.4%
Screen resolution 240 x 320 px 480 x 800 px
Screen PPI /points per inch/ 125 PPI 217 PPI
Screen protection Corning Gorilla Glass Corning Gorilla Glass

Performance

Operating system - OS Android 2.1 (Eclair), upgradable to 2.2 (Froyo); Sense UI Android 2.1 (Eclair), upgradable to 2.3 (Gingerbread); Sense UI
Chipset - Qualcomm MSM7225 Snapdragon S1 - Qualcomm QSD8650 Snapdragon S1
CPU - 528 MHz ARM 11 - 1.0 GHz Scorpion
GPU No Adreno 200
External memory microSD, up to 32 GB (dedicated slot) microSD, up to 32 GB (dedicated slot), 8 GB included
Internal memory 384 MB RAM; 512 MB 1 GB, 512 MB RAM
